To avoid plagiarism, you need to cite and reference the sources you use in your writing. During this workshop, we’ll discuss how to cite and reference properly, and give you tips on how to do it effectively.

Recommended for Bachelor's and Master's WUR students writing an essay, a report, or a thesis.

Content

During this workshop, we’ll discuss the following citing and referencing issues:

  • why, what and when to cite;
  • ways to cite (paraphrasing, summarising, quoting);
  • in-text citations and reference lists;
  • style selection;
  • citing and referencing images; and
  • reference managers.
